Had to put my boy down less than 2 years ago. Rottweiler/shepard mix.
My constant companion and wrestling pal. The house isn't the same without him.

Had a mobile service come to the house and do the deed. Laying with him in front of the fireplace
where we spent many an evening. First injection, you could see his pain easing, and he licked my face.
Second one, he was gone within seconds. They waited outside for me. I carried him out later.

Highly recommend the mobile service if you can do it. Wasn't much more than the regular service.
And so much nicer having him at home.
